Just noticed this AM and I’m pretty aware of how the car is doing so I doubt it’s been happening much before now. Until the engine is warm (it seems) there is a ticking coming from the engine near the middle right of the engine bay looking into the compartment from the nose. This is a 06 Altima with a 3.5L transversely mounted V6 if that helps anyone navigate. Nothing has changed in the maintenance, fuel, etc. It’s actually a little warmer lately these last couple of days, about 38F at startup. Noise isn’t present when the car is warm, however, after driving about 15 miles home and sitting at the gym for about an hour and 20 minutes it came up again. Amb temp at that time was 32F. 1 mile home and it had stopped. It’s not the timing chain as it’s located in completely separate part of the bay and I know its noise.

The engine is DOHC. It doesn't have lifters.

It may however have hydraulic lash adjusters.
 
See if you can pinpoint the location. You can take a long tube like the cardboard sleeve from wrapping paper and hold it to your ear and then move the other end along the engine listening for the noise and where it is the loudest.

Be sure to listen around the injectors as well. I have never had one completely fail, but have had a couple that started to tick loudly in two different Nissan vehicles. A shock dosage of upper cylinder lube along with a bottle of Gumout Regane stopped it on my Sentra. On the 240sx it didn't help, so I isolated the ticking one and replaced it.
